Understanding Diamond Carat Weight

What is Carat Weight?

Carat weight is one of the four key factors that determine a diamond's value, alongside cut, color, and clarity—commonly referred to as the "Four Cs." A carat is a measure of weight, with one carat equaling 200 milligrams. This measurement is important because, generally speaking, the larger the diamond (in carats), the more valuable it tends to be.

However, it’s essential to note that carat weight does not directly correlate with size alone; the diamond's cut significantly influences its appearance. For example, a well-cut diamond will appear larger than a poorly cut diamond of the same carat weight.

The Average Carat Size for Engagement Rings

In recent years, the average carat size for engagement rings has seen some shifts. In the UK, the average weight is around 0.6 carats, while in the United States, it hovers closer to 1 carat. As we look toward 2024, many couples are gravitating towards diamonds that weigh between 1.25 to 2 carats, a size that beautifully balances presence and affordability.

When discussing what is considered a "big" diamond, it’s important to consider context—cultural norms, personal preferences, and social circles all play a role. For some, a 1.5-carat diamond may feel substantial, while others might view 2 carats or more as the benchmark for a "big" engagement ring.

The Impact of Shape on Perceived Size

The shape of a diamond can also affect how large it appears. For instance:

  • Round Brilliant Cut: This classic shape is known for its brilliance and can appear larger due to its sparkling facets.
  • Oval Cut: This shape can give the illusion of a longer, larger stone without necessarily increasing carat weight.
  • Cushion Cut: With its softer edges, this shape is often perceived as more delicate and can be visually appealing at lower carat weights.

Factors Influencing Diamond Size Perception

Social Circles and Cultural Norms

What is considered a "big" diamond can vary dramatically based on social circles and cultural expectations. In affluent areas or among certain social groups, diamonds over 2 carats may not be uncommon, while in other communities, a 1-carat diamond might be seen as more than sufficient.

As you contemplate the ideal size for your engagement ring, consider what resonates most with your personal values and the expectations of your community. It’s about finding a balance that aligns with your personal style while also feeling comfortable in your social context.

Finger Size Matters

Another key factor to consider is the recipient's finger size. A larger diamond may look more proportionate on a larger finger, while a smaller diamond can appear just as stunning on a petite hand. Exploring Different Diamond Shapes and Their Symbolism

Round Brilliant Cut

The round brilliant cut is the most popular shape for engagement rings, known for its timeless elegance and ability to maximize sparkle. This shape is often associated with love and commitment, making it a classic choice for engagement rings.

Princess Cut

The princess cut is a modern favorite, combining the brilliance of the round cut with a unique square shape. This cut symbolizes strength and beauty, appealing to those who appreciate contemporary design.

Oval Cut

The oval cut offers a unique twist on the classic round diamond, often appearing larger due to its elongated shape. This cut is celebrated for its elegance and is a popular choice for those seeking a distinctive look.

Cushion Cut

The cushion cut features a vintage charm with its soft, rounded edges. This shape symbolizes romance and nostalgia, making it an excellent choice for couples who appreciate timeless beauty.

Emerald Cut

The emerald cut is known for its sophisticated, elongated shape and large facets, which highlight the diamond's clarity. This cut is often associated with luxury and refinement.
